In Islam, Alcohol is forbidden to drink, but is allowed to be used for medical and other purposes, for example industrial use.

The word "alcohol" itself is among the List of exported Arabic terms.

Several Qur'anic verses prohibit the consumption of alcohol, and dealing with such beverage.
